Why Upper Materials Matter for Girls Casual Sandals Comfort

When it comes to girls casual sandals comfort, the upper material plays a much bigger role than most parents realize. Think of the upper as the part that hugs the foot. If that hug is too stiff, rough, or sweaty, comfort disappears fast—especially during daily play, school outings, or family walks.

Soft upper materials reduce friction, prevent blisters, and allow natural foot movement. They’re also essential for long-term foot health, especially during growth years. What Makes a Material “Soft” and Foot-Friendly?

A soft upper material isn’t just about texture. It’s about flexibility, breathability, adaptability, and skin-friendliness. The best materials move with the foot instead of resisting it.

For girls casual sandals comfort, ideal uppers should:

  • Feel smooth against bare skin
  • Stretch slightly without losing shape
  • Allow airflow for warm weather use
  • Avoid pressure points during movement

1. Soft Genuine Leather

Genuine leather remains a gold standard for comfort. It naturally molds to the foot over time, creating a custom fit that reduces irritation.

Best Use Cases for Leather Sandals

Leather uppers are ideal for daily wear sandals, especially when combined with thoughtful fit-focused designs and cushioned soles.


2. Nubuck Leather

Nubuck is leather with a velvety surface, softer than standard leather and gentler on sensitive skin. It adds a premium feel without stiffness.


3. Suede Leather

Suede is lightweight and flexible, making it perfect for casual and fashion-forward designs. It pairs well with style-driven casual sandal designs while maintaining comfort.


4. Breathable Mesh Fabric

Mesh uppers are a favorite in breathable sandals thanks to their airflow and feather-light feel.

Why Mesh Works for Warm Weather

Mesh keeps feet cool, dry, and irritation-free—perfect for summer play and warm weather sandals.


5. Cotton Canvas

Canvas is soft, natural, and skin-friendly. It’s often used in minimalist designs for everyday fashion footwear.


6. Microfiber Synthetic

Microfiber mimics leather softness but adds water resistance and easy care. It’s a smart choice for daily wear sandals.

7. Neoprene Fabric

Neoprene stretches gently around the foot, reducing pressure points. It’s especially useful in toddler sandals where flexibility is key.

8. Knitted Textile Uppers

Knitted uppers adapt like socks, offering unmatched comfort and movement freedom. These are popular in comfortable kids footwear categories.


9. Eco-Friendly Vegan Leather

Modern vegan leather options are soft, breathable, and aligned with sustainable footwear values.


10. Padded PU Leather

PU leather with inner padding adds plush comfort while maintaining durability. Ideal for casual comfort sandals.


11. Soft Foam-Backed Fabric

Foam-backed uppers act like cushions for the foot, enhancing daily movement support.


12. Lycra Stretch Fabric

Lycra stretches without squeezing, making it excellent for growing feet and girls casual sandals.


13. Felted Textile Uppers

Felted fabrics offer warmth, softness, and lightweight comfort, often used in minimalist sandals.


14. Memory Foam-Lined Uppers

Memory foam linings absorb pressure and adapt instantly, boosting overall girls casual sandals comfort.


15. Natural Cork-Blend Fabric Uppers

Cork-blend uppers provide flexibility and eco benefits, pairing well with eco-friendly sandals.

FAQs

1. Which upper material is best for girls casual sandals comfort?

Soft leather, mesh, and knitted textiles offer the best balance of comfort and durability.

2. Are synthetic materials bad for comfort?

Not at all—modern microfiber and PU options are designed specifically for comfort.

3. How do I know if a sandal upper is too stiff?

If it doesn’t bend easily or feels rough against skin, it’s likely too stiff.

4. Are eco-friendly materials comfortable for kids?

Yes, many sustainable materials are softer and more breathable than traditional options.

5. Should sandals stretch as kids grow?

Yes, stretch-friendly uppers like Lycra help accommodate growth.

6. Can upper material affect foot health?

Absolutely—poor materials can cause blisters, pressure points, and discomfort.

7. How often should I replace girls casual sandals?

Replace them when uppers lose softness or no longer adapt comfortably to the foot.
